How much do closing manager j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for closing manager in Minnesota is $16.32,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.65 and $17.64 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the responsibilities of a closing manager?

The responsibilities of a real estate closing manager include working with processors, underwriters, and other professionals to complete all the necessary documents for mortgage loans. They are expected to hire, train, supervise, and guide closers to help improve their efficiency and sales. Additional duties include analyzing any relevant title or escrow to ensure compliance with federal and state regulations. A closing manager often coordinates the closing schedule, helps the settlement agent with changes, and completes a post-close review.

What are some common challenges a closing manager faces when coordinating with multiple departments during the closing process?

A Closing Manager often encounters challenges in aligning timelines and requirements among various departments, such as sales, legal, and finance. Ensuring all documentation is accurate and submitted on time can be complex, especially when last-minute issues arise. Effective communication and problem-solving skills are essential to manage competing priorities and avoid delays. Proactively identifying potential bottlenecks and maintaining clear, consistent updates with all stakeholders can help ensure a smooth closing process.

What is a closing manager?

A closing manager is a supervisory role responsible for overseeing the final operations of a business or store at the end of the day, including cash handling, ensuring security, and completing daily reports. They often coordinate staff, verify procedures, and ensure compliance with company policies during closing shifts.

What is the role of a closing manager?

A closing manager oversees the final operations of a business shift, ensuring all tasks are completed accurately and efficiently. They handle cash reconciliation, staff coordination, and ensure compliance with safety and company policies, often using point-of-sale systems and management tools.

Job description

Now Hiring at Jimmy John's - New Hope (Winnetka Ave. #1650)!
We're looking for a Closing General Manager tolead our team.
Pay: $42-$47K per year.
All hours, all days available!
Be part of a high-energy crew that's all about freaky fast and freaky fresh!


General Manager

PRIMARY PURPOSE OF THE POSITION:

General Managers are responsible for all aspects of operating and supervising the store.

  • Manage all functions of a Jimmy John's restaurant to ensure exceptional customer service and high quality products are delivered, while ensuring restaurant profitability.
  • Responsible for directing the successful execution of fast, accurate sandwiches and world-class customer service while maintaining a clean, organized shift.
  • Expected to interact effectively with all levels of the organization, as well as the broader Jimmy John's Company.

MAJOR D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Establish the store's labor goals and staff needs, including pay rates.
  • Manage a staff of approximately 3 to 15 employees. Assign, oversee and evaluate work.
  • Manage hiring, training, evaluation, discipline, and termination of employees.
  • Provide on-the-job training for new employees.
  • Delegate and responsible for the ordering, receipt, storage and issuing of all food, labor, equipment, cleaning, and paper supplies for the unit to ensure a minimum loss from waste or theft.
  • Supervision of the preparation, sales, and service of food.
  • Order the appropriate amount of food items to meet anticipated customer demand.
  • Supervise food preparation and service operations.
  • Ensure that every customer receives world-class customer service.
  • Route deliveries and serve drivers to maximize delivery business and speed.
  • Execute systems and procedures with 100% integrity and completeness.
  • Complete daily and weekly paperwork.
  • Responsible for 100% of the cash drawers at all times during the shift.
  • Implement corporate policies.
  • Control inventory by using a weekly inventory system and maintaining regular inventory ordering schedules.
  • Receive and store product.
  • Conduct weekly manager's meetings.
  • Audit systems and procedures as well as shift-ending paperwork.
  • Arrange for preventive maintenance and upkeep on store's equipment and supplies.
  • Perform other related duties as required.

AS TIME PERMITS

  • Assist in-shoppers during rush periods to ensure the maintenance of restaurant efficiency.
  • Assist in-shoppers in greeting customers, taking orders, using the cash register, assembling order and checking for completeness and correctness.
  • Complete daily food preparation (opening procedures, meat and vegetable slicing, bread production).

SKILLS AND ABILITIES

  • Oral and written communication skills.
  • Ability to establish priorities, work independently, and proceed with objectives without supervision.
  • Ability to handle and resolve customer threats and issues.
  • Ability to handle and resolve employee issues.
  • Ability to use a personal computer and various software packages (Word / Excel).
  • Ability to handle stress and high-volume operations.
  • Interpersonal skills to work effectively with others, motivate employees, elicit work output and deal with customers.

QUALIFICATIONS FOR POSITION

  • High school graduate or equivalent training.
  • Completion of recommended corporate training programs.
  • Valid driver's license, reliable transportation, current automobile insurance, and a clean driving record.
  • Experience with a retail food company is a plus.

P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S

  • Position requires bending, standing and walking the entire workday.
  • Must be able to lift 50 pounds.
  • Must be at least 19 years of age.
  • Must have the stamina to work a minimum of 50-60 hours a week.
